The International Exposition of Contemporary and Modern Art, renews their partnership with Artspace.com, the leading online marketplace for contemporary art. The online platform enables art lovers throughout the world to preview and participate in EXPO CHICAGO, which opens the international fall art season Sept. 19 - 22 at Navy Pier. Artspace will expand EXPO’s audience by reaching a growing base of over 200,000 collectors and its vast network of museum trustees, directors and curators from around the world.

“EXPO CHICAGO proved to be a major player in the international contemporary art scene in its first year,” said Artspace Co-Founder and Chairman Christopher E. Vroom. “We look forward to partnering again in 2013 to elevate global exposure for the fair’s outstanding exhibitors and programming.”

Assembling a curated selection of 120 leading international contemporary and modern art galleries, EXPO CHICAGO provides collectors and art enthusiasts access to the top international art galleries with an unparalleled exhibition of works. Through the partnership with Artspace, EXPO CHICAGO is broadening this interaction beyond the walls of the fair. Artspace.com is changing the way the world experiences art, providing an online showcase of the galleries’ work leading up to and during EXPO CHICAGO. The website allows collectors first access to preview, browse and inquire about available works showcased by EXPO’s prominent roster of galleries, facilitating acquisitions at the fair.

Hand-picked international curators will select and highlight their favorite works displayed at EXPO to write about on the Artspace website which now includes editorial by top art writers including former Editor of Artnet Magazine, Walter Robinson. This content supports Artspace’s mission to educate and engage new collectors about art, acting as an art advisor to those beginning new collections.

In addition to virtually building EXPO’s outreach, Artspace will exhibit at the exposition as well, showing editions for purchase from many of its 100 partners including non-profits and cultural institutions such as the Solomon R. Guggenheim Museum, Brooklyn Museum, ICA Boston, Museum of Contemporary Art Chicago, among others.

“We are extremely proud to renew and build upon our partnership with Artspace," said President and Director of EXPO CHICAGO Tony Karman. “Artspace is leading and redefining the online marketplace for contemporary art. We are extremely grateful for the innovative opportunities that they are providing to our exhibitors and for their influential outreach to arts patrons worldwide.”

About EXPO CHICAGO

Art Expositions, LLC presents EXPO CHICAGO, The International Exposition of Contemporary and Modern Art. Situated at Navy Pier’s Festival Hall (600 E. Grand Ave.), Sept. 19 – 22, this four-day art event features over 120 leading international galleries and offers diverse programming including /DIALOGUES, IN/SITU and EXPOSURE. Under the leadership of President and Director Tony Karman, EXPO CHICAGO draws upon the city’s rich history as a vibrant destination for arts and culture helping to define the contemporary art community in Chicago while inspiring the city’s collector base. Vernissage, the opening night preview benefiting the Museum of Contemporary Art Chicago takes place Thursday, Sept 19. General Admission to the exposition is Friday, Sept. 20 – Sunday, Sept. 22. About Artspace.com

Founded in March 2011 by Christopher Vroom and Catherine Levene, Artspace.com is the only online platform where collectors can purchase works by top contemporary artists directly from leading commercial galleries and prestigious cultural institutions, including The Metropolitan Museum of Art, The Solomon R. Guggenheim Museum, Paula Cooper Gallery, David Zwirner Gallery and White Cube. As a part of the Artspace Limited Edition series, the company’s curators also commission exclusive works of art directly from the most exciting artists working today including Lawrence Weiner, Peter Coffin, Wangechi Mutu and Marcel Dzama, working closely with the artists, their studios and master printers to produce work of exceptional quality in small editions.
